Part 12 contains numerous questions related to an applicant’s moral character and is the section of the N-400 that is usually the most difficult for learners.Parts of the interview. At the naturalization interview, a USCIS officer will ask you a series of questions to decide if you can become a U.S. citizen. It has 3 main parts: Questions about your Form N-400. An English test to check your ability to speak, read, and write basic English. When preparing Form N-400, Application for Naturalization, you have the opportunity to select certain exemptions. You are exempt from the English language requirement if you are: Age 50 or older at the time of filing Form N-400 and have lived as a permanent resident (green card holder) in the United States for 20 years or more.
